About

Improve your English listening skills in a big way with these helpful tips!
What would it mean to your studies or career to be able to listen fluently in English? The habits and study tips in 71 Ways to Practice English Listening: Tips for ESL/EFL Learners are designed to improve your English listening quickly and easily.
Jackie Bolen and Jennifer Booker Smith have nearly thirty years’ experience teaching ESL/EFL. In this book, they have organized the advice they have given countless students to help reach their listening goals from improving a test score, to getting a job, to watching English movies and TV, or traveling around the world. It really is possible to improve your listening skills, whether you're a beginner, or advanced student.

In this book, you'll find out how reading more can improve your listening, where to find the best free resources online, and how to make the most of your study time. You'll also find some fun ideas for improving your listening. There is even a tip about how to eavesdrop well! This is the second book in the Tips for English Learners series by Jackie Bolen.
